HindustaniTimes.com: Indian-origin banker, musician Chandrika Tandon wins best New Age album Grammy

Sunday night was celebration day for Indian-born American musician Chandrika Tandon. At 71, she won her first Grammy — the award for Best New Age, Ambient or Chant Album for Triveni, a collaborative effort also featuring the music of three-time Grammy-winning South African flautist Wouter Kellerman and Japanese-origin cellist Eru Matsumoto…
